Transaction e161eaba33513d02201389561448be1e33fc865ade77dcb5816c5c159f5bf0d8
1 Input
1 Output
-
e161eaba33513d02201389561448be1e33fc865ade77dcb5816c5c159f5bf0d8:0
- value
- 5285540360
- script pubkey
- OP_0 OP_PUSHBYTES_32 937cead1bffc508508625c59a8ff938dc2bf84096886ae4a17225127f320429e
- address
- bc1qjd7w45dll3gg2zrzt3v63lun3hptlpqfdzr2ujshyfgj0ueqg20qurgd7d